Output 26955861c79e64cdbfee7766a91ccfe7859cd2c49c5dfb03d5a6a732ae7f4bfb:0

value
4139
script pubkey
OP_0 OP_PUSHBYTES_20 a451a14f7d3e31c7c3f65c5f30c107151d00144d
address
bc1q53g6znma8ccu0slkt30npsg8z5wsq9zdefrq7t
transaction
26955861c79e64cdbfee7766a91ccfe7859cd2c49c5dfb03d5a6a732ae7f4bfb
confirmations
41677
spent
true